## What is it?
This is a Python Noodle Extensions Editor for Beat Saber levels. Manually editing a JSON file over a long period of time can get really annoying, so this should speed up the process!\

## Sample
```py
import noodleExtensions as NE

editor = NE.NoodleExtensions(r"level.datpath")

# assign to a new track
dropNote = NE.Note(5, 1, 0, 0, 8)
editor.editNote(dropNote, NE.Note(5, 1, 0, 0, 8, _track="FallDownTrack"))

FallDownTrack = NE.AnimateTrack(2, "FallDownTrack", 2, _position=[
  [0, 100, 0, 0], # be in the sky before it appears
  [0, 0, 0, 0.75, "easeOutBounce"], # fall down in front of player and finish animation just in time for the player to hit it
])
editor.animateTrack(FallDownTrack)

# push events to the level.dat so it can be ready to play
editor.pushChanges()
```
# Pull Request
To make a pull request, please test your code either using [pytest](https://docs.pytest.org/en/stable/) or your python testing env. of your choice.\
I will not be accepting any form of pull request if the test files have not been modified to fit your modifications.
1. Fork this project
2. Edit code 
3. *Test* your code
4. If check 3 is done, move on to step 5
5. Make the pull request
